Why These Are the Top Audi Repair Auto Repair Shops in Spooner

The Audi repair market in Spooner, Wisconsin itself is extremely limited, with no dedicated Audi specialists operating within the city limits. For specialized services, residents must look to larger metropolitan areas. The Twin Cities (Minneapolis-St. Paul) metro area, approximately a 90-minute drive from Spooner, serves as the primary hub for high-quality, specialized Audi repair. This market is highly competitive, featuring both authorized dealerships and several highly-regarded independent specialists. The competition helps maintain high standards of service quality and technical knowledge. Pricing in this market is tiered; dealerships command a premium for OEM parts and factory certification, while top-tier independents offer significant savings (often 20-40%) while maintaining expert-level service. For Spooner residents, this means access to world-class Audi service is available, albeit with the necessity of traveling to the Twin Cities or Duluth for the most complex or certified repairs.

What are the most common Audi repair issues you see in Spooner, Wisconsin, due to our local climate and roads?

Given Spooner's cold winters and road salt use, we frequently address premature brake corrosion, suspension component wear from potholes, and issues with the Quattro all-wheel-drive system related to harsh seasonal transitions. Electrical gremlins from moisture and battery failures in extreme cold are also common local concerns for Audi owners.

Are Audi repairs more expensive in Spooner compared to larger cities, and what's a typical price range for common services?

Labor rates in Spooner can be slightly lower than in metro areas, but parts costs remain consistent. For example, a standard brake service may range from $350-$600, while a major service like a timing chain replacement on a 2.0T engine can cost $2,000+. Always request a detailed, written estimate upfront.

What local driving considerations in Northwestern Wisconsin should influence my Audi's maintenance schedule?

The combination of gravel road dust, winter salt, and temperature extremes means you should adhere strictly to severe service intervals. We recommend more frequent undercarriage washes to fight rust, earlier brake inspections due to stop-and-go rural driving, and ensuring your cooling system and battery are tested before each winter.
